Jamberoo Lookout Budderoo is a breathtaking viewpoint located on Jamberoo Mountain Road, on the edge of the coastal escarpment.

It offers a panoramic view of the Pacific Ocean and the surrounding landscape. Visitors can admire the stunning view from the viewing platform, which overlooks the valley and the ocean. On a clear day, you can see Kiama, Lake Illawarra, and even Five Islands off the coast of Wollongong. The lookout is an ideal location for landscape photography and bird-watching. You can also take a leisurely stroll or cycle along Budderoo Track or take a refreshing walk through Minnamurra Rainforest Centre. The best time to visit Jamberoo Lookout Budderoo is during the spring and summer months when the weather is mild and the skies are clear. Visitors can access the lookout from Jamberoo Mountain Road, which is approximately 8 km west of Kiama. The road leading to the lookout is steep and winding, so caution is advised when driving. Parking is available at the lookout site, and there are picnic areas nearby for those who want to have a leisurely picnic with a spectacular view.
